Best Chardon Public High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 1,097 students in Chardon, OH.
The top ranked public high school in Chardon, OH is Chardon High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Chardon, OH public high school have an average math proficiency score of 66% (versus the Ohio public high school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 74% (versus the 57% statewide average). High schools in Chardon have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Ohio public high schools.
Chardon, OH public high school have a Graduation Rate of 96%, which is more than the Ohio average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Chardon High School, with 96%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Ohio or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public high school average of 33% (majority Black).
